Dating Confidence Reset
Start by clarifying what you actually want. Before swiping or messaging, name one or two realistic goals for your next week—whether that’s having three short conversations, arranging one phone call, or simply replying to messages within 24 hours. Small, concrete goals keep you focused and reduce the pressure to make every interaction feel decisive.
Pace conversations with intention. Match the other person’s tempo for the first few exchanges: if they write short messages, keep it light; if they write thoughtfully, respond in kind. When you want more clarity, ask one clear question about their priorities or availability instead of several at once. This helps you learn quickly without overwhelming the chat.
Set realistic expectations. Remember that most conversations don’t become relationships—and that’s normal. Treat early chats as information-gathering, not judgment moments. Look for consistency over time (replies, follow-through on plans) rather than immediate chemistry. That reduces disappointment and protects your confidence.
Notice progress, however small. Track wins that matter to you: a better first message, a call that lasted longer than usual, or leaving a conversation with more clarity. Celebrating small steps trains your brain to see growth and keeps you motivated without relying on external validation.
Choose matches more thoughtfully. Use a short checklist: shared interests that matter to you, compatible communication style, and basic deal-breakers (availability, location, smoking, etc.). When a profile or conversation fails to meet your essentials, it’s okay to move on—doing so saves time and preserves energy for better fits.
Keep emotional steadiness as a practice. When you feel discouraged, pause and do one grounding activity—walk, breathe, or write down three strengths you bring to dating. Limit checking apps to set times so every unread message doesn’t drive your mood. If a message hurts, wait before replying; a calm response keeps your dignity and reduces impulsive decisions.
